手持设备自动定位方法

文档序号:7896649阅读:341来源:国知局
专利名称:手持设备自动定位方法
技术领域
本发明涉及一种电子设备的定位方法,特别涉及一种应用手持设备中传感器的配合进行位置确定的方法。
背景技术
现在很多手持设备比如手机(Mobile Phone)、导航仪(GPS)、移动网络设备(MID) 等都可以通过内置的导航模块来得到当前设备的经纬度信息,甚至可以通过地图数据得到当前所处的街道位置。但是这样的位置信息无法让手持设备知道使用者为什么会在这个地方,他们会在这个地方做什么,手持设备如何做才能更适合使用者在这个地方使用。更具体一点的说,手持设备得到当前的经纬度信息或者街道信息,但是却不知道这个位置是居所还是公司或者是在室外,手持设备是放在包里还是放在桌面上,是静止不动还是在运动中。 而恰恰是这些更精确的信息才能使手持设备为使用者在不同的环境中提供不同的服务。而目前的手持设备并不会根据当前用户所处的环境或者手持设备所处的环境来动态调整所提供的功能、服务,随着技术的发展,手持设备一定会从死的设备变得更加智能,手持设备会像人一样根据当前的位置环境提供相应的服务。随着技术的发展,现在越来越多的手持设备加入了各种各样的传感器,但是这些传感器目前还只是简单的用途,比如距离传感器只是用于在接听电话时关闭屏幕,而光线传感器只是感知光线强弱来调节背光亮度,动作传感器只是用于翻转屏幕,声音传感器或者降噪芯片只是用来降噪。这些传感器并没有被很好的利用。本发明则提供一种使用各种传感器来精确判断位置信息的方法,用以改善或解决上述的问题。

发明内容
本发明要解决的技术问题在于提供一种手持设备自动判断位置信息的方法。本发明通过这样的技术方案解决上述的技术问题本发明提供一种手持设备自动定位方法,该方法包括如下步骤提供中央处理器; 提供存储模块;提供计时模块;提供定位模块;定义至少第一时间段与第二时间段,并存储在存储模块中;计时模块与定位模块将当前时间信息与位置信息提供给中央处理器;中央处理器判断当前时间是否为第一时间段或第二时间段范围内,并将对应的位置信息保存至存储模块;将多次保存的位于第一时间段内的相同的位置信息保存至存储模块并定义为第一场所,将多次保存的位于第二时间段内的相同的位置信息保存至存储模块并定义为第二场所。作为一种改进,该步骤还包括提供一光线传感器用以监测手持设备当前环境的光亮度并提供给中央处理器。作为一种改进,该步骤还包括提供一距离传感器用以监测手持设备与当前环境中其他物体之间的距离并提供给中央处理器。
作为一种改进,该步骤还包括提供一动作传感器用以监测手持设备当前的运动状态并提供给中央处理器。作为一种改进,该步骤还包括提供一声音传感器用以监测手持设备当前环境嘈杂度并提供给中央处理器。作为一种改进,中央处理器综合各种传感器的状态来精确判断当前的位置情况。作为一种改进,中央处理器从定位模块接收到的第一时间段或第二时间段内的位置若连续不同于第一位置或第二位置,则重新定义新的位置为第一位置或第二位置。与现有技术相比较,本发明具有以下优点利用本发明的方法,可精确判断手持设备当前位置信息,能使手持设备为用户在不同的环境中提供不同的服务,并根据当前用户所处的环境或者手持设备所处的环境来动态调整所提供的功能、服务。


图1是本发明涉及的手持设备的系统架构图。图2是本发明手持设备自动定位方法中判断居所和工作场所的流程图。图3是本发明手持设备自动定位方法中判断在外出差或游玩地流程图。
具体实施例方式下面结合附图详细说明本发明的具体实施方式
。一般来说,位置信息可以精确地分为居所、工作地点、室外等。而办公场所又可分为安静的办公室、嘈杂的市场或卖场、走家串户的推销员等。手持设备的精确位置信息还可以包括是在桌上还是在包中或口袋中。一天有24个小时,手持设备会跟着使用者在一天的时间内到达多个地方。一般来说使用者在工作时间应该是在上班,下班时间会在居所。如果既不是在居所也不是在工作地点,那一般来说工作日时间应该是在外出差,休息日时间应该是在外游玩。因此,本发明手持设备自动定位方法中的第一步骤是先设置工作时间和下班时间,如周一至周五每天的08 30 18 00定义为工作时间,周一至周五每天的18 00至次日 08:30以及周六周日为休息时间。实际上,上述时间可自定义为其他时间段,未必是工作时间或休息时间,可根据用户需要自行设定,只要有所区分即可,因此,可概括成第一时间段和第二时间段等,也可根据实际需要定义多种时间段。请参图1,为本发明所涉及的手持设备的系统框图,该电子设备10包括中央处理器11、计时模块12、定位模块13、光线传感器14、距离传感器15、动作传感器16、声音传感器17以及其他实现各种功能的传感器18。除了上述外,实际还需要一存储模块。其中,中央处理器11负责收集上述各模块及传感器的上报信息,并根据这些上报信息确定需执行的功能;计时模块12主要用以提供当前时间;定位模块13主要用以确定手持设备当前经纬度,可以为GPS模块;光线传感器14主要用以确认手持设备当前环境的光亮度;距离传感器15主要确定手持设备与当前环境中物体之间的距离关系;动作传感器 16主要监测设备当前运动与否;声音传感器17主要用以监测手持设备当前环境的声音大小;其他传感器18主要为实现其他数据测量提供帮助。存储模块用以记录位置信息或者自定义时间段等,可以使中央处理器的一部分,也可以是单独的元件。
中央处理器根据计时模块12上报的时间信息的不同来做判断,计时模块12上报中央处理器11的当前时间如果在定义的工作时间内,中央处理器11则将调用工作时间内的执行程序,如果在定义的休息时间内,则调用休息时间内的执行程序。另外,中央处理器 11从定位模块13获得当前的位置信息,记录并存储下来,经过一段期间的监测与存储,如果这个位置基本不变,那就可以确定这个地方就是办公场所还是居所,因为工作时间内的不变的位置可认为是工作场所,而休息时间内的不变的位置可认为是居所。请参图2,是判断居所和办公场所的流程图,即,计时模块提供当前时间给中央处理器,中央处理器判断当前时间位于工作时间范围内还是休息时间范围内,再从定位模块获取位置信息,并作记录与存储,多次判断后,可认为工作时间内的相同位置为工作场所,而休息时间内的相同位置为居所。
确定居所和办公地点之后,如果定位模块获得的位置信息不是这两个地点,即,中央处理器从定位模块获取的位置信息既不是确认的居所,也不是确认的工作场所,则可判断手持设备当前是在室外,如果是工作时间可以认为是在外办公,如果是休息时间则可认为是在外游玩。图3是本发明手持设备自动定位方法中判断在外出差或游玩地流程图,定位模块上报当前位置给中央处理器,中央处理器确定当前位置既不是居所也不是办公场所,则从计时模块获得当前时间,如果是工作时间则认为是在外办公或出差,如果是休息时间则认为是在外游玩。实际上,先获取位置信息还是时间信息不重要,重要的是两者之间的综合判断。如果连续多次工作时间在同一个非工作地点或是休息时间在同一个非居所地点, 则可能是换工作或者是搬家,系统将重新更新新的工作场所或新的居所地点。如果工作时间的地点经常变化,则认为用户为非固定工作地点,可能是推销员、快递员等。中央处理器从声音传感器获得当前环境的噪音,可以确定工作环境是安静的办公室还是嘈杂环境,我们把嘈杂环境统称为卖场环境。如果是在室外,中央处理器从动作传感器得到手持设备的运动情况,可以确定当前是在移动中还是在静止状态。根据以上描述,本方法可以比较精确的判断出当前位置是居所、工作场所或是室夕卜,工作场所又可进一步精确判断出是办公室、卖场或是非固定工作地点,室外又可精确判断出是出差中还是在外游玩。实际上,居所还是工作场所仅是距离而已,可以根据需要自定义多个场所,如第一场所、第二场所等。本方法还可以通过距离传感器来获得当前手持设备所处的环境,比如是在桌面上的空旷环境还是在包中或是口袋中。通过光线传感器来确定当前环境是黑暗环境还是亮光的环境。中央处理器打开距离传感器获得手持设备周围的距离情况,如果检测不到物体,则说明是在空旷的环境下,可以认为是在桌面上;如果检测到有物体,则说明手持设备周围有物体,可能是被东西压着或者是在包中,统称为包中。中央处理器打开光线传感器单元获得手持设备周围的光照情况,如果光照很好, 则说明是在比较亮的境况下,如果光照很暗甚至全黑,则可以认为是在黑暗的房间或者在很密闭的包中,此时打开距离传感器确定周围物体,如果没有检测到物体,则说明是在黑暗的房间,如果有物体则说明是在密闭性比较好的包中。经过以上步骤,可以使得中央处理器自动判断手持设备当前位置,并且调用执行程序,比如,在工作时间,监测到手持设备是在比较安静的工作场所的话,将自动降低铃声音量,而在比较嘈杂的工作场所的时候,则提升音量等。当然,还有其他利用这些位置信息以及传感器获得的数据调用其他有利于提升用户体验的程序的情形,不一一例举。总之,通过中央处理器综合各种传感器的状态或者提供的数据来精确判断当前的位置情况,以提供用户更加智能且贴心的应用环境。
以上所述仅为本发明的较佳实施方式,本发明的保护范围并不以上述实施方式为限,但凡本领域普通技术人员根据本发明所揭示内容所作的等效修饰或变化,皆应纳入权利要求书中记载的保护范围内。
权利要求
1.一种手持设备自动定位方法,其特征在于,该方法包括如下步骤提供中央处理器;提供存储模块;提供计时模块;提供定位模块;定义至少第一时间段与第二时间段,并存储在存储模块中;计时模块与定位模块将当前时间信息与位置信息提供给中央处理器;中央处理器判断当前时间是否为第一时间段或第二时间段范围内,并将对应的位置信息保存至存储模块;将多次保存的位于第一时间段内的相同的位置信息保存至存储模块并定义为第一场所,将多次保存的位于第二时间段内的相同的位置信息保存至存储模块并定义为第二场所。
2.根据权利要求1所述的手持设备自动定位方法,其特征在于,该步骤还包括提供一光线传感器用以监测手持设备当前环境的光亮度并提供给中央处理器。
3.根据权利要求1或2所述的手持设备自动定位方法,其特征在于,该步骤还包括提供一距离传感器用以监测手持设备与当前环境中其他物体之间的距离并提供给中央处理器。
4.根据权利要求1或2所述的手持设备自动定位方法,其特征在于,该步骤还包括提供一动作传感器用以监测手持设备当前的运动状态并提供给中央处理器。
5.根据权利要求1或2所述的手持设备自动定位方法,其特征在于,该步骤还包括提供一声音传感器用以监测手持设备当前环境嘈杂度并提供给中央处理器
6.根据权利要求1或2所述的手持设备自动定位方法,其特征在于,中央处理器综合各种传感器的状态来精确判断当前的位置情况。
7.根据权利要求1所述的手持设备自动定位方法,其特征在于,中央处理器从定位模块接收到的第一时间段或第二时间段内的位置若连续不同于第一位置或第二位置,则重新定义新的位置为第一位置或第二位置。
全文摘要
本发明涉及一种手持设备自动定位方法,该方法包括如下步骤提供中央处理器;提供存储模块;提供计时模块;提供定位模块;定义至少第一时间段与第二时间段,并存储在存储模块中;计时模块与定位模块将当前时间信息与位置信息提供给中央处理器;中央处理器判断当前时间是否为第一时间段或第二时间段范围内,并将对应的位置信息保存至存储模块;将多次保存的位于第一时间段内的相同的位置信息保存至存储模块并定义为第一场所,将多次保存的位于第二时间段内的相同的位置信息保存至存储模块并定义为第二场所。本发明可精确判断手持设备当前位置信息,并根据当前用户所处的环境或者手持设备所处的环境来动态调整所提供的功能、服务。
文档编号H04W4/02GK102170608SQ20101060236
公开日2011年8月31日 申请日期2010年12月23日 优先权日2010年12月23日
发明者吴志恒 申请人:上海恒途信息科技有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1